Wells Fargo Downgrades Sherwin-Williams Amid Rising Costs from Iran Conflict

Wells Fargo downgraded Sherwin-Williams, citing concerns that rising raw material costs, exacerbated by the Iran conflict, will squeeze the company's margins and negatively impact its stock.
